Tokyo 21 Sushi Bar and Nightclub offers a wide variety of food and drinks at an affordable price. The menu includes specialty sushi dishes, maki, and rolls as well as courses for those not quite brave enough to venture into the world of raw fish. This came in helpful being a beginning sushi eater myself. The menu was actually a little different than the one posted online at http://www.tokyo21chicago.com/tokyo.html
I started with the Tempura Shrimp, easy and simple. I liked it and felt brave, so I ordered the Rainbow Maki. Seemed I had skipped a few steps as I was not ready for this. The rice and the asparagus and cream cheese on the inside was excellent, it was the raw tuna draped over it I had a hard time swallowing. I moved on to the unique tasting Mango Lobster Roll. I was glad to have tried al f these, but was still not full as I could not eat more than one or two, so I ordered the Kalbe Maki. Warm and delicious, this was the safe way out; it was a piece of Kobe Beef wrapped around an asparagus spear and a scallion.
If I had to sum up the atmosphere in one word, it would be fun. All of the guests seemed to be having a great time as was the staff. After dinner, we had a drink at the bar which was lit up by florescent red and blue alternating lights around a big screen TV. The drink menu included a long list of saki and many other creative drinks.
Tokyo 21 is an excellent place for any sushi lover or anyone on their way to becoming one. I was glad to have made this my first sushi experience. Our waiter could not have been more friendly or more helpful.
